a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orTreehugger Robot <treehugger-gerrit@google.com>2022-11-08 01:15:59 +0000
committerGerrit Code Review <noreply-gerritcodereview@google.com>2022-11-08 01:15:59 +0000
commitbe013898a2fbcc1e11c9f3c1c51cb7ec01c513df (patch)
tree4b9608187e1bf7bc639ee168aa23cc060dbe6f0c
parent52cb0349f15082579aa3f1d3be024795b4ebe06d (diff)
parentb9f0f50b670b179f59f26bab610ce4dcdd8aaca7 (diff)
downloadbuild-be013898a2fbcc1e11c9f3c1c51cb7ec01c513df.tar.gz
Merge "Support system_dlkm in GSI" into android13-gsi
-rw-r--r--target/board/BoardConfigGsiCommon.mk6
-rw-r--r--target/product/gsi_release.mk1
2 files changed, 7 insertions, 0 deletions
diff --git a/target/board/BoardConfigGsiCommon.mk b/target/board/BoardConfigGsiCommon.mk
index 53714a8594..89305b40ad 100644
--- a/target/board/BoardConfigGsiCommon.mk
+++ b/target/board/BoardConfigGsiCommon.mk
@@ -17,6 +17,12 @@ BOARD_SYSTEMIMAGE_FILE_SYSTEM_TYPE := $(GSI_FILE_SYSTEM_TYPE)
TARGET_USERIMAGES_SPARSE_EXT_DISABLED := true
TARGET_USERIMAGES_SPARSE_EROFS_DISABLED := true
+# Enable system_dlkm image for creating a symlink in GSI to support
+# the devices with system_dlkm partition
+BOARD_USES_SYSTEM_DLKMIMAGE := true
+BOARD_SYSTEM_DLKMIMAGE_FILE_SYSTEM_TYPE := ext4
+TARGET_COPY_OUT_SYSTEM_DLKM := system_dlkm
+
# GSI also includes make_f2fs to support userdata parition in f2fs
# for some devices
TARGET_USERIMAGES_USE_F2FS := true
diff --git a/target/product/gsi_release.mk b/target/product/gsi_release.mk
index 74501cd1f1..9587d975c4 100644
--- a/target/product/gsi_release.mk
+++ b/target/product/gsi_release.mk
@@ -78,6 +78,7 @@ PRODUCT_BUILD_USERDATA_IMAGE := false
PRODUCT_BUILD_VENDOR_IMAGE := false
PRODUCT_BUILD_SUPER_PARTITION := false
PRODUCT_BUILD_SUPER_EMPTY_IMAGE := false
+PRODUCT_BUILD_SYSTEM_DLKM_IMAGE := false
PRODUCT_EXPORT_BOOT_IMAGE_TO_DIST := true
# Always build modules from source